Git是一种流行的版本控制工具,它可以帮助开发人员更好地管理自己的代码。更新到最新版本是使用Git的重要一步。本文将从多个方面介绍如何使用Git更新到最新版本。
一、使用git pull命令
更新到最新版本的最简单方法是使用git pull命令。该命令可以将远程存储库中的最新更改合并到本地存储库中。
$ git pull
当您运行此命令时,Git将自动获取最新的更改,并将其合并到本地代码库中。
使用git pull更新您的代码库是推荐的方法,因为它可以确保您的本地代码库与远程存储库保持同步。
二、使用git fetch和git merge命令
如果您想更好地控制Git如何与远程存储库进行交互,那么可以使用git fetch和git merge命令。
首先,您可以使用git fetch命令从远程存储库获取最新更改,但是这些更改不会自动合并到本地代码库中。
$ git fetch
然后,您可以使用git merge命令将远程主分支合并到本地主分支中。
$ git merge origin/master
在此示例中,我们假设您要将远程存储库的主分支合并到本地代码库的主分支中。
使用git fetch和git merge命令可以更好地控制Git如何与远程存储库进行交互,但是也需要更多的工作。
三、使用git rebase命令
另一种更新到最新版本的方法是使用git rebase命令。
与git merge不同,git rebase将重新应用本地更改,以便它们适应最新的远程更改。这可以产生更干净的提交历史记录。
使用git rebase命令更新您的代码库的步骤如下:
- 从远程存储库获取最新更改
- 将本地代码库重新基于最新更改
- 处理冲突
$ git fetch
$ git rebase origin/master
更新到最新版本是使用Git的重要一步。无论您是使用git pull,git fetch和git merge还是git rebase命令,都需要确保您的本地代码库与远程存储库保持同步。